*Los Angeles County Department of Public Health Showcases Critical Programs During Public Health Week *

*(April 6 - 12)*

"Events Held Throughout the Week Highlight Community Health, Prevention, and Action"

The Los Angeles County Department of Public Health will join health departments across the nation in kicking off National Public Health Week, observed April 6 through April 12, 2026. This year’s theme, *“Ready. Set. Action!”* highlights the importance of taking meaningful steps to protect and improve community health.

“The past year has been challenging, yet together, we have continued to advance health and well-being across our communities,” said Barbara Ferrer, PhD, MPH, MEd, Director of the Los Angeles County Department of Public Health. “As we mark National Public Health Week, we uplift the dedication, skill, and commitment of everyone in our public health family. Every day, their efforts make a real difference, helping our communities thrive, stay safe, and secure resources needed for well-being.”

“This year’s theme reminds us that public health begins in our neighborhoods and in the work we do together,” Ferrer added. “It is our collaboration, care, and persistence that prevent disease, promote wellness, and create the conditions for everyone to live healthier lives. Public health does not happen by accident. It requires all of us - policymakers, community partners, organizations, and residents — working together to strengthen prevention and ensure that every person has the opportunity to be healthy.”

Throughout the week, Public Health will host a series of events across Los Angeles County that reflect the breadth of public health work, from emergency preparedness and children’s health to small business support and protecting workers. These events highlight efforts to strengthen prevention, expand access to resources, and build healthier, more resilient communities.

"*The Los Angeles County Departmen**t of Public Health* "

"The Department of Public Health is committed to promoting health equity and ensuring optimal health and well -being for all 10 million residents of Los Angeles County. Through a variety of programs, community partnerships and services, Public Health oversees environmental health, disease control, and community and family health. Nationally accredited by the Public Health Accreditation Board, the Los Angeles County Department of Public Health comprises of more than 5,000 employees and has an annual budget of $1.3 billion."
